i used to crap on straight talk as well until my wife came home with a $210 bill for 2 cel phones for one month.

But you can eat with that bring your own phone plan where you buy the sims
That one uses ATT or t-mobile towers




base straight talk ( phone- no sim required, where you just walk into walmart and buy one) most use sprint :flabbynsick:

i had heard there was one that uses verizon, but it only had a 3.5" screen

I did a lot of research on this before switching , so use the info for whatever its worth.

But I pull 3G, and 3G HSDA ( ATT 4G equivalent ) everywhere


You can check for the bands that work for 3G in the US
for either ATT or T-mobile

but this phone has them all
2G: GSM 850/9001800/1900MHz
3G: WCDMA 850/900/1700/1900/2100MHz

its basically a world phone
but the WCDMA controls your data speeds

if I remember correctly ATT uses the 850 & 1900
you need both, some states use 850 , some use 1900 some use both
but Google that if you are serious about an unlocked phone, it may have changed

but i have been on straight talk like 2 years and have not had any issues.
For the data throttling , when i am at the house i use wifi anyway so that saves lots of data
